In this role, you will:

Provide leadership and oversight of daily workflow, quality control and staff performance in the Accessioning Department to ensure the highest quality patient care. Will accurately receive, sort and accession specimens sent to Cunningham Pathology for preparation and diagnosis. Accountable for all technical, personnel, quality control and administrative functions in order to produce timely, high-quality specimen receiving, accession data entry, test ordering, and distribution of workload to other laboratory departments.

  • Directs the activities of the department staff to ensure efficiency by optimizing accessioning workflow to expeditiously deliver specimens to other departments while maintaining critical focus on quality.

  • Receives and processes derm, surgical, cytology and clinical specimens from referring physicians, ensuring accurate specimen identification and documentation on all logs. Duties consist of but are not limited to the following:

  • Receives and accounts for all specimens

  • Documents receipt of specimens utilizing standard format and notations

  • Sort specimens by specimen type

  • Ensures requisitions are completed correctly/completely

  • Accurately performs data entry of all patient and site information

All you need is:

  • Bachelor’s degree in related field or equivalent work experience

  • 2+ years previous supervisory experience preferred. Prior laboratory experience required
